Transaction 89df48a40cdcf2a8cf0432420ff52b65641194a7cb19b859dba8f50cf5ecf429
1 Input
1 Output
-
89df48a40cdcf2a8cf0432420ff52b65641194a7cb19b859dba8f50cf5ecf429:0
- value
- 13154605
- script pubkey
- OP_0 OP_PUSHBYTES_20 0f3a634f2d0a3e3c6f83690c89cee6eea83e7319
- address
- bc1qpuaxxnedpglrcmurdyxgnnhxa65ruuceru8a3f